- Overview
- Audience
- Prerequisites
- Curriculum
Description:
This course introduces participants to the core concepts and services of Google Cloud Platform (GCP), providing a strong foundation for cloud adoption and usage. It is designed for beginners who want to understand cloud computing concepts and how they are applied within GCP.
The training covers GCP global infrastructure, compute, storage, networking, and database services, alongside practical demonstrations of IAM, billing, and resource management. Participants will gain a holistic understanding of GCP’s key services and architectural patterns.
Hands-on labs allow learners to navigate the GCP Console and Cloud Shell, configure IAM policies, create virtual machines, and deploy applications using App Engine and Kubernetes Engine. Data storage labs with Cloud Storage and databases further reinforce learning.
By the end of this training, participants will be able to confidently use the GCP Console and CLI, deploy basic workloads, secure resources, and design simple architectures. This course serves as a stepping stone toward role-based certifications such as Associate Cloud Engineer.
By the end of the training, participants will be able to design, train, and deploy scalable ML solutions on AWS SageMaker, manage model performance, and apply best practices to build AI-powered applications. The program also provides a strong foundation for professionals preparing for the AWS Machine Learning Specialty certification.
Duration: 3 Days
Course Code: BDT 521
Learning Objectives:
After this training, participants will be able to:
- Understand GCP’s global infrastructure and service model
- Navigate the GCP Console and Cloud Shell
- Deploy and manage computing, storage, and networking resources
- Apply IAM roles, billing, and monitoring best practices
- IT professionals and system administrators new to GCP
- Developers and technical managers exploring cloud adoption
- Business leaders evaluating Google Cloud capabilities
- Learners preparing for Associate Cloud Engineer certification
- Basic understanding of IT systems and networking
- Familiarity with Linux or Windows administration
- No prior GCP experience required
- An active Google Cloud Free Tier account for labs
Course Outline:
Module 1: Welcome to GCP Fundamentals
- What is cloud computing?
- GCP architecture and network
- Regions, zones, and pricing innovations
- Multi-layered security
Module 2: Resource Hierarchy and IAM
- Resource hierarchy in GCP
- IAM roles and policies
- Cloud Marketplace
- Demo: Getting Started with Cloud Launcher
Module 3: Virtual Private Cloud (VPC) and Compute
- VPC overview and capabilities
- Computer Engine basics
- Demo: Getting Started with Compute Engine
Module 4: Storage Options
- Cloud Storage and interactions
- Bigtable, Cloud SQL, Spanner, Datastore
- Comparing storage options
- Demo: Getting Started with Cloud Storage and Cloud SQL
Module 5: Containers and Kubernetes
- Introduction to Kubernetes and Kubernetes Engine
- Demo: Getting Started with Kubernetes Engine
Module 6: App Engine and Application Services
- App Engine Standard vs Flexible Environment
- Cloud Endpoints and Apigee Edge
- Demo: Getting Started with App Engine
Module 7: Development and Monitoring in the Cloud
- Infrastructure as code with Deployment Manager
- Monitoring with Stack driver
- Demo: Getting Started with Deployment Manager and Monitoring
Module 8: Big Data and Machine Learning
- Cloud Dataflow and Big Query
- Cloud Pub/Sub and Data lab
- Machine Learning APIs
- Demo: Getting Started with Big Query
Training material provided: Yes (Digital format)



